STEM OPT Application Security Engineer Jobs

Application Security Engineer roles qualify for STEM OPT because they fall under computer science and engineering CIP codes. Your 24-month STEM OPT extension gives you up to 36 months of total work authorization, provided your employer is enrolled in E-Verify and you file a completed I-983 training plan with your DSO.

Tips for Finding STEM OPT Authorization as an Application Security Engineer

Verify your degree CIP code first

Check that your degree's CIP code falls under an approved STEM category before applying. Computer science (11.xx), information security (11.1003), and engineering (14.xx) codes all qualify, but some interdisciplinary degrees don't. Confirm eligibility with your DSO before targeting roles.

Confirm E-Verify enrollment before accepting offers

Any employer who hires you on STEM OPT must be enrolled in E-Verify, not just willing to enroll. Ask recruiters directly and verify through the E-Verify employer search before signing anything. A non-enrolled employer disqualifies your extension regardless of role fit.

Target security teams at regulated industries

Financial services, healthcare, and defense contractors face strict compliance mandates that create standing demand for application security engineers. These industries file consistent STEM OPT training plans and are familiar with I-983 requirements, reducing delays after you receive an offer.

Build your I-983 training plan around AppSec milestones

Don't wait until offer acceptance to draft your I-983. Map your planned work to specific learning objectives tied to secure SDLC, penetration testing, or threat modeling. A well-prepared training plan speeds DSO approval and signals readiness to compliance-aware employers.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does an Application Security Engineer role qualify for the STEM OPT extension?

Yes, if your degree is in a qualifying STEM field such as computer science, information security, or software engineering. The role itself must also provide structured learning tied to your degree, which you document in the I-983 training plan. Application security work typically maps cleanly to these requirements because it involves technically complex, degree-relevant skills. Your DSO makes the final eligibility determination based on your specific degree CIP code.

What E-Verify requirements does my employer need to meet for STEM OPT?

Your employer must be actively enrolled in E-Verify at the time you begin work on the STEM OPT extension. Enrollment after hiring does not satisfy this requirement retroactively. You can check employer enrollment status through the E-Verify employer search tool. The employer must also sign your I-983 training plan, confirming they will provide the documented learning experience for the full extension period.

What goes into the I-983 training plan for an Application Security Engineer?

The I-983 requires you to describe specific training goals tied to your STEM degree, the skills you'll develop, and how the employer will supervise and evaluate your progress. For an application security role, this typically includes objectives around secure code review, vulnerability assessment, threat modeling, or incident response. The employer's designated supervisor signs the plan, and you submit it to your DSO before the extension begins. You also file an evaluation update at the 12-month mark.

How does cap-gap protection apply if my employer files an H-1B petition while I'm on STEM OPT?

If your employer files an H-1B petition before your STEM OPT EAD expires and you're selected in the lottery, cap-gap automatically extends your work authorization through September 30 of that fiscal year. You don't need to file separately for cap-gap. Your I-20 should be updated by your DSO to reflect the cap-gap period. USCIS confirms the underlying rules governing this extension, so verify your specific dates with your DSO.
